Women take over the Dénia stage: this is the musical program for May

Information
Start date: May 05th 2023
Finish date: May 26th 2023
Event type: Concert
Site: Social Center
Schedule: 20: 00
Home: Free with reservation

Women with musical styles ranging from pop, flamenco, classical music or traditional Valencian singing come together in Dénia in the 'Dona i Música' cycle. Each of the four participating artists will perform on a Friday in May at the Social Center, at 20:00 p.m.

The cycle will be opened by María Bertomeu, the maryplatforms, Friday May 5, with the presentation of his album of traditional Valencian music L'Assumpció. His musical proposal has been defined as transgressive regarding the genre and unclassifiable. With musical training anchored at the Oliva music school since he was 6 years old and specializing in Valencian singing from the José Manuel Izquierdo Professional Conservatory of Catarroja, with Xavier de Bétera as a teacher, La María offers an opportunity to understand the Valencian musical tradition so in a different way. She is part of a new batch of artists who assume tradition as the best tool for innovation.

El viernes 12, it will be the turn of the fusion of flamenco and blockmusic with influences of hip hop, jazz, neosoul and new urban music with the group labadu. Its leader is Pastora Andrade, singer and bassist born in Algeciras in 1989 into a family of musicians/musicians. She is she is accompanied by Juanma Montoya on guitar, Josué Ronkío on bass and David Bao on drums. The formation has collaborated with artists such as Ketama, Jorge Pardo, Pepe Bao or Kiki Morente.

The next appointment will be on viernes 19, with the singer Esther, which will present her second album, Les cartes que mai vaig cremar, a pop proposal where the young singer-songwriter explores new sounds and reaffirms herself as one of the freshest and most current voices of pop in Valencian. A record that navigates between the intimate pop of Kodaline, Juditt Neddermann or Retama with the fresh and magnetic energy of artists like Miley Cyrus.

The cycle will close viernes 26 the musical and theatrical proposal Deixa'm dir, a show focused on the vindication of women in the world of music. The cast is made up of the soprano Consuelo Hueso, the pianist Renata Casero and the performers of the Casulana Quintet; all under the stage direction of Alabama Laura Salido to stage the musical works of the composers Sonia Megías, Ángeles López Artiga, Matilde Salvador, María Teresa Oller, Consuelo Colomer, Sara Galiana and Mercé Torrents.
